What Is a Senior Discount?
A senior discount is a promotional tactic used by businesses to attract older adults, typically defined as people age 60 or 65 and older, depending on the organization. At the State Fair of Texas, these discounts can apply to admission fees, food, merchandise, or even transportation services. They aim to make the fair more accessible by providing financial incentives to seniors, ensuring that they can enjoy a full day of activities at a more affordable price.
Availability of Senior Discounts
1. Discount Days and Offers
During the State Fair of Texas, which runs annually in the fall, the organizers often designate specific days as "Senior Days." For these special days, seniors can either enjoy discounted entrance fees or, in some cases, free admission. It's important to check the fair's official schedule to identify when these days occur, as they can vary each year. Typically, discounts are more generous on weekdays when the crowd levels are lower.

Steps to Avail Senior Discounts
1. Verify Age Requirements
Before heading to the fair, ensure you understand the age requirements set forth to qualify for a senior discount. The age usually starts at 60 or 65, but checking the specific policy of the fair will save you time and effort.
2. Plan Your Visit
By using the fair's official schedule and map, identify which days and events you want to attend. Planning beforehand can help make the most of available discounts and offers, especially if you're targeting discounts on special 'Senior Days.'
3. Gather Required Identification
Make sure to bring a valid form of identification that verifies your age, such as a driver’s license, state ID, or passport. Some discounts may require this verification at ticket booths or entry points to secure the lower rate.
4. Purchase Tickets in Advance
Whenever possible, purchase your tickets in advance. This can often be done online through the State Fair of Texas website or through designated sales points. Purchasing in advance not only secures your spot but also allows access to further online discounts or promotions not available at the gate.
Tips for Seniors Attending the Fair
Attending the State Fair of Texas can be a delightful experience filled with sights, sounds, and tastes that define Texan culture. Here are some additional tips to make your visit more enjoyable:
- Timing: Consider visiting during weekdays or early hours to enjoy smaller crowds and cooler weather, which can make navigating the fairgrounds much easier.
- Health & Comfort: Wear comfortable shoes and light clothing. The fair spans a large area, and it’s important to stay comfortable. Also, ensure that you stay hydrated and take breaks as needed.
- Accessibility: The fair provides accessible facilities, including ramps and reserved seating at certain events. If needed, mobility aids like wheelchairs or scooters are often available for rent.
- Safety: Keep an eye on personal belongings, and use fair-provided maps to navigate safely. It's also a good idea to identify lost and found centers or security points upon arrival.
